The Switch 4400 supports the following port security modes, which you
can set for an individual port or a range of ports:
No Security
Port security is disabled and all network traffic is forwarded through
the port without any restrictions.
Continuous Learning
MAC addresses are learned continuously by the port until the number
of authorized addresses specified is reached. When this number is
exceeded the first address that was learned by the port is deleted,
allowing a new address to be learned.
Automatic Learning
MAC addresses are learned continuously by the port until the number
of authorized addresses specified is reached. When this number is
exceeded the port automatically stops learning addresses and

Network Login
When the user has been successfully authorized, all network traffic is

Network Login (Secure)
When the user has been successfully authorized, only network traffic
that is received from the authorized client device is forwarded through
the port. The source MAC address in received packets is used to
determine this; all traffic from other network devices is filtered.
Disconnect Unauthorized Device (DUD) is enabled on the port.
Network Login with NBX
This mode allows an NBX phone and a client device to be used on the
same Switch port. The client device is connected to the user port on
the NBX phone, which in turn is connected to the Switch port. Traffic
on the NBX phone is automatically forwarded. Traffic on the client
device is forwarded when the user has been successfully authorized.
Disconnect Unauthorized Device (DUD) is enabled on the port.
